on Tuesday evening, July 9, 2025, there was a clear violation of environmental law in Geislingen an der Steige. At around 5 p.m., an attentive witness in Türkheim, more precisely in Kirchgasse, watched a suspicious maneuver of a 19-year-old man. This parked his Renault Twingo shortly at the hiking car park near the church and got out on the passenger side. He put a plastic shopping basket filled with a bag of garbage, off next to a trash can before he jumped into the car again and drove away. The witness acted quickly, noted the license plate and informed the police, who has now started investigations against the vehicle owner. It remains unclear whether the man himself or a friend is responsible for improper waste disposal.

Such an incident does not remain without consequences. In Germany, waste disposal is subject to the district administration law (KRWG), and the fines vary depending on the state. In Baden-Württemberg, the penalties for improper waste disposal can be sensitive. For example, fines between 50 and 200 euros can be expected in the illegal deposit of bulky waste. If waste is disposed of with sharp edges, even penalties of 25 to 100 euros are due. In the case of more serious violations, such as the disposal of old vehicles, the fines can be between 150 and 300 euros. This shows how seriously the authorities take environmental protection - because the annual waste revenue in Germany amounts to around 325 to 350 million tons, which leads to the need for strict controls.
